Acne Skin Care Idea # 1: Make Sure you Always Clean Your Skin Pretty Gently

Firstly, individual hygiene is pretty crucial for fighting acne. So as what most gurus normally recommend, you need to softly clean your skin with a mild cleanser a minimum of twice each day. This easy acne skin care step is deemed critical for fighting acne since washing your face or other affected areas will wipe away the acne-causing bacteria discovered on the skin. Also realize that although you're sometimes told to scrub your face, scrubbing isn't a great acne skin care move because it will only trigger the development of acne, worsening the condition. Additionally to this acne skin care step, it's worth noting that astringents aren't always advised except if the skin is extremely oily. And, they should only be used on the oily spots.

Acne Skin Care # 2: You Ought To Refrain from Frequently Holding Your Skin

The other useful acne skin care suggestion is to prevent frequently handling of the skin. Don't pinch, pick or squeeze your pimple because it will only worsen the condition. Plenty of persons have considered this acne skin care step as one of the most critical acne skin care pointers understanding that it might only cause infection and scars formation. As this acne skin care tip holds, you need to keep away from rubbing and touching your skin lesions if it is possible.

Acne Skin Care # 3: Always Select Cosmetics Very Carefully

This last acne skin care idea holds that individuals who're being treated for acne should change some of the cosmetics they use. Realize that in order to prevent the onset or the development of acne, the cosmetics you plan on utilizing like the foundation, blush, moisturizers, and eye shadow has to be oil free. In addition, this acne skin care idea also holds that you should prevent oily hair products for they might cause closed comedones. Consequently, those stuff that are labeled as noncomedogenic has to be applied.
